Details
A vulnerability classified as problematic has been found in Axesstmc Zucchetti Axess CLOKI Access Control 1.64. This affects an unknown code. The manipulation with an unknown input leads to a cross-site request forgery vulnerability. CWE is classifying the issue as CWE-352. The web application does not, or can not, sufficiently verify whether a well-formed, valid, consistent request was intentionally provided by the user who submitted the request. This is going to have an impact on integrity. The summary by CVE is:
Zucchetti Axess CLOKI Access Control 1.64 contains a cross-site request forgery vulnerability that allows attackers to manipulate access control settings without user interaction. Attackers can craft malicious web pages with hidden forms to disable or modify access control parameters by tricking authenticated users into loading the page.
The weakness was disclosed by Gjoko Krstic as 50595. It is possible to read the advisory at exploit-db.com. This vulnerability is uniquely identified as CVE-2021-47722 since 12/07/2025. The exploitability is told to be easy. It is possible to initiate the attack remotely. No form of authentication is needed for exploitation. It demands that the victim is doing some kind of user interaction. Technical details are unknown but a public exploit is available.
The exploit is shared for download at exploit-db.com. It is declared as proof-of-concept.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
